cordova platform add android 报错问题解决

一般会有2种错误:

一种是下面这种网络问题:

C:\Users\65185\Desktop\myApp>cordova platforms add androidError: Failed to fetch platform androidProbably this is either a connection problem, or platform spec is incorrect.Check your connection and platform name/version/URL.Error: shasum check failed for C:\Users\65185\AppData\Local\Temp\npm-5308-3316eaf5\registry.npmjs.org\cordova-android\-\cordova-android-5.2.1.tgzExpected: f707b60008246e9dce02c5f3fdcc5555d7d9ab69Actual:   c4c6d2873d47ec8a955dae1c9d305e0209b74f56From:     https://registry.npmjs.org/cordova-android/-/cordova-android-5.2.1.tgz



这种问题一般是网络问题,需要更改镜像源:

npm config set registry https://registry.npm.taobao.org

一般改为淘宝镜像源就可以了。

第二种错误:

另一种是执行版本错误:


Error: Failed to fetch platform android Probably this is either a connection problem, or platform spec is incorrect.Check your connection and platform name/version/URL.Error: version not found: [email protected]

你可以查看下C:/Users/%USER%/.cordova/lib/npm-cache/cordova-android 下面的文件

如果你的cordova-android平台版本是5.1.1

那么你就需要执行cordova platform add [email protected]

我的是5.2.1,所以就是cordova platform add [email protected]

问题解决~~

更多相关文章

  1. android各个版本代号
  2. android 网络请求get,post实现
  3. Android判断是否有可用网络和判断WIFI是否ON
  4. 查看已經下載好ANDROID源碼是什麽版本號
  5. 百度地图移动版API 1.2.2版本(Android)地图偏移的最佳解决办法
  6. js判断移动终端浏览器版本信息
  7. 老版本ndk 下载链接
  8. Android 的一个错误的解决
  9. Android studio解决错误:SSL peer shut down incorrectly

随机推荐

  1. 关于MySQL实现指定编码遇到的坑
  2. 为什么MySQL 删除表数据 磁盘空间还一直
  3. mysql中int(3)和int(10)的数值范围是否相
  4. 深入解析MySQL索引数据结构
  5. MySQL数据库必备之条件查询语句
  6. MySQL实例精讲单行函数以及字符数学日期
  7. MySQL数据库超时设置配置的方法实例
  8. Error generating final archive
  9. Android(安卓)是否前台运行
  10. android之显示Log